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P2

The NM_001366683.2(DOCK9):c.4481C>T(p.Ala1494Val) variant causes a missense change. The variant allele was found at a frequency of 0.0000157 in 1,588,188 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

DOCK9 (HGNC:14132): (dedicator of cytokinesis 9) Enables cadherin binding activity. Predicted to be involved in positive regulation of GTPase activity. Located in membrane.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May 18, 2022The c.4415C>T (p.A1472V) alteration is located in exon 41 (coding exon 41) of the DOCK9 gene. This alteration results from a C to T substitution at nucleotide position 4415, causing the alanine (A) at amino acid position 1472 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
